Poison Pill

Noun: A poison pill is a strategy used by a company to prevent a hostile takeover by implementing certain defensive measures that make the acquisition undesirable or unprofitable for the acquiring party.

Example sentence: The board of directors implemented a poison pill, allowing the company's shareholders to purchase additional shares at a discounted price, making a hostile takeover extremely costly.
